How do I know what size bowls I need?
Finding Your Perfect Bowl Size: It's All About the Fit
Choosing the right-sized bowl often feels like a surprisingly complex task. Do you need a tiny ramekin or a massive mixing bowl? The answer isn't simply about capacity; it's about the ergonomic sweet spot – the perfect balance between functionality and comfortable handling.
While a larger bowl might seem like the obvious choice for minimizing spills, a bowl that's too unwieldy can become a source of frustration and accidents. Imagine struggling to stir a heavy bowl of soup, risking a messy mishap. Conversely, a bowl that's too small might require constant refills, interrupting the flow of your meal or cooking process.
The key to finding the perfect bowl size lies in the experience of holding it. The ideal bowl should feel natural and secure in your hand, not too heavy to lift or too small to grip comfortably. This subjective element is crucial; what feels perfect for one person might be cumbersome for another.
So, how do you determine your ideal bowl size? The answer lies in experimentation. Visit a kitchenware store or browse online retailers with a variety of bowl sizes. Consider the following:
-
Intended Use: A bowl for cereal will have different size requirements than a bowl for a hearty salad or a mixing bowl for baking. Think about the typical volume of food or ingredients you'll be using.
-
Hand Size: Your hand size significantly impacts how comfortable a bowl feels. Someone with larger hands might prefer a larger, deeper bowl, while smaller hands might find a more compact size easier to manage.
-
Material: The weight of the bowl material also plays a role. A heavy ceramic bowl will feel different in your hand compared to a lighter plastic or metal one.
-
Shape: Bowl shape contributes to comfort. A wide, shallow bowl might be easier to access for scooping, while a taller, narrower bowl might be better for holding liquids.
The best approach is to try out different sizes. Pick up several bowls of various diameters and depths, paying close attention to how they feel in your hand. The right size should feel intuitive and effortlessly manageable. You should feel confident and in control, not strained or awkward. This personalized approach ensures you'll find bowls that enhance your culinary experience rather than hindering it. Don't underestimate the importance of finding that perfect fit – it makes all the difference in your kitchen comfort and efficiency.
